Mariella added three newspaper commentaries about the cozy relationships between the developer industry and a couple of your county commissioners.
Steve Otto says it all smells fishy, and Dan Ruth suggests that Brian Blair and Ken Hagan are nothing but a couple of whores for developers. But one sentence in Ruth’s column says all you need to know about politics in Hillsborough County:
They don’t care about being perceived as hot walkers for anyone with a shovel, because they also know they’ll probably get re-elected.
And he’s probably right. Until young people start paying attention to local politics, you can expect more of the same.
Talk to your kids, talk to your co-workers, and talk to your friends about this stuff. Explain what the commissioners do, and let them know what they are doing.
The development lobby has lots of money to spend on campaigns. They are able to effectively get the message out with advertising. The anti-development lobby does not have gobs of money laying about, so they must respond by getting the word out cheaply.
The only way to make changes is to make sure everyone knows what these jackasses are doing, and get them voted out.
